No Job Security. Use and throw. Hire and fire. Be careful which team you join. - Senior Java Developer Intercontinental Exchange Employee Review

Pros

Learnings. As it is a product based company, you can learn a lot.

Cons

1.) Job Security. If you are directly working with onsite people, then your job is at at most risk. Myself worked with onsite folks having 20-30 years of experience. No matter how you perform, they never get satisfied due to huge experience difference. Hence, they ask you to leave. 2.) No Team work Again, if you are working directly with onsite people, they is no concept of team work. You wont get any support from, them no concept of KT, and at the same time, they expect you to deliver on time. Those people have been woking in the same company for the last 15-20 years and they expect the new joiners to work similar to them. If you dont (ofcourse you cant, to be practical. No concept of KTs, no team work and still they expect 8 years exp person to work like a 30 years exp person), then they fire. I have seen firing 3-4 new joiners because of performance. To be honest, It was not performance. It was lack of "Common Sense" from onsite folks.
